Nuggets beat T-Wolves to clinch West's 2nd seed:

Jamal Murray , The Canadian Pressscored 29 points and had a key strip in the closing seconds for the Denver Nuggets, who scored the game's final 15 points in a 99-95 win over the Minnesota Timberwolves on Wednesday night that secured the No. 2 seed in the Western Conference playoffs.

"We didn't give up," Jokic told the crowd after the Nuggets pulled out the improbable win to set up a first-round playoff series with the seventh-seeded San Antonio Spurs, instead of sixth-seeded Oklahoma City.added 17 points, including the go-ahead 3-pointer with 31 seconds left that put Denver up 96-95. Jokic stripped, who led the Timberwolves with 25 points, and then sank two free throws for a three-point cushion.

was fouled at the other end with 4.2 seconds remaining. He sank his first free throw and missed his second, but teammateadded 18 points for the Timberwolves backups and rookiescored a career-best 17 points, including a 3-pointer that put Minnesota ahead 95-84 with 4:01 left.Jokic also pulled down 14 rebounds one night after his worst game of the year, one in which he scored just two points before fouling out in 16 minutes in a loss at Utah.

A year ago, these two teams met on the final day of the regular season with a lot more at stake. The Timberwolves won that one in overtime in the first final-day play-in game in the NBA in 21 years, ending a 14-year playoff absence and extending Denver's drought to six seasons.demanded a trade that torpedoed the Timberwolves, who fell to 36-46 and reverted to also-ran status while the Nuggets put together a 54-28 breakout for their first trip to the playoffs since 2012-13.

"Each one of our players deserves credit, because they've all bought in from Day 1," Malone said."And I think we've used that motivation of losing in Minneapolis last year Game 82 because coming up short two years in a row is really hard and it's kind of motivated us to be the team we are right now."
